RICHARD L. RYSTICKEN
(1934 - 2005)

Richard L. Rysticken, age 70, of 722 S. 30th St., Manitowoc, died unexpectedly Wednesday afternoon, Aug. 17, 2005, at Holy Family Memorial Medical Center, Manitowoc.

He was born Aug. 22, 1934, in Manitowoc, son of the late Leo and Mabel Strouf Rysticken. Richard was a graduate of Manitowoc Lincoln High School, class of 1953. On Nov. 16, 1957, he married the former Lorraine Fogeltanz at St. Joseph Catholic Church, Kellnersville. Richard was employed at Mirro Aluminum Company and Foley for 42 years, retiring in 1994. He was a member of the Show Sportsman Club and had a love for the outdoors. He will be remembered for his sense of humor and loyalty towards his family and friends. His greatest joy was time spent with his best friend, his loving wife.

Survivors include his wife: Lorraine Rysticken, Manitowoc; two daughters and a son-in-law: Cindy and Greg Uhen, River Hills, Wis.; Diane Hochkammer, Cherry Valley, Ill.; five grandchildren: Ben, Sarah and Danny Uhen; Andrew and Adam Hochkammer; two brothers and sisters-in-law: Tom and Lynn Rysticken, Two Rivers; Jim and Marilyn Rysticken, Manitowoc; two brothers-in-law and three sisters-in-law: John and Joyce Fogeltanz, Kellnersville; Don and Sandy Fogeltanz, Kellnersville; and Joyce Fogeltanz, rural Cato. Also surviving are nieces, nephews, other relatives and friends. He was also preceded in death by his mother-in-law and father-in-law: John and Monica Fogeltanz; and a brother-in-law: LeRoy Fogeltanz.

A memorial service will be held at 11 a.m. Saturday, Aug. 20, 2005, at The Pfeffer Funeral Home & Cremation Care Center, Manitowoc. Officiating at the memorial service will be the Rev. Richard Klingeisen. Cremation has taken place.

Friends may call at The Pfeffer Funeral Home & Cremation Care Center, Manitowoc, from 9:30 a.m. Saturday, Aug.i 20, 2005, until the time of service at 11 a.m.

In lieu of flowers, a memorial will be established in Richard's name.

Manitowoc Herald Times Reporter Friday, August 19, 2005 pg. A3
